Routledge handbook of comparative political institutions
Jennifer Gandhi (Editor), Rubén Ruiz-Rufino (Editor)
"The Routledge Handbook of Comparative Political Institutions (HCPI) is designed to serve as a comprehensive reference guide to our accumulated knowledge and the cutting edge of scholarship about political institutions in the comparative context. It differs from existing handbooks in that it focuses squarely on institutions but also discusses how they intersect with the study of mass behaviour and explain important outcomes, drawing on the perspective of comparative politics"-- Provided by publisher
